You can now open reports on your phone with the Power BI app

Microsoft has released an update for the Power BI apps on Windows 10 Mobile, allowing users of said apps to open up reports on their smartphone. Hitting a tile in focus mode and choosing "open report" will see the app load data in landscape mode, ready for analysis.
As well as simply gazing at the report on-screen, it's also possible for businesses and enterprise customers to interact with the data by touching on a value to cross-filter, slice and even highlight other related visualizations on a single page.
